xdg-open is default for file manager

This commit is contained in:
Marcos Pinto 2007-08-10 08:16:37 +00:00
parent 28ad94ea6e
commit ec579fe2d9
4 changed files with 484 additions and 480 deletions

File diff suppressed because it is too large Load Diff

View File

@ -179,4 +179,4 @@ class EncLevel:
class ProxyType:
none, socks4, socks5, socks5_pw, http, http_pw = range(6)
class FileManager:
choose_one, konqueror, nautilus, thunar = range(4)
choose_one, konqueror, nautilus, thunar, xdg = range(5)

View File

@ -639,6 +639,8 @@ class DelugeGTK:
file_manager = "nautilus"
if self.config.get("file_manager") == common.FileManager.thunar:
file_manager = "thunar"
if self.config.get("file_manager") == common.FileManager.xdg:
file_manager = "xdg-open"
elif self.config.get("open_folder_custom"):
file_manager = self.config.get("open_folder_location")
@ -1010,6 +1012,7 @@ class DelugeGTK:
_("Up Speed"), ulspeed, ulspeed_max, plugin_messages)
self.tray_icon.set_tooltip(msg)
print self.config.get("file_manager")
def update_torrent_info_widget(self):
unique_id = self.get_selected_torrent()

View File

@ -40,7 +40,7 @@ import common
import os.path
DEFAULT_PREFS = {
"file_manager" : common.FileManager.choose_one,
"file_manager" : common.FileManager.xdg,
"open_folder_stock" : True,
"open_folder_custom" : False,
"open_folder_location": "",